What is a factor?
number that divides evenly into another number.
What makes a number prime?
It has exactly two factors — 1 and itself.

List all factor pairs of 12.
(1,12), (2,6), (3,4)
Is 9 prime or composite? Explain.
Composite — 9 has more than two factors (1, 3, 9).

Find all factor pairs of 36.
(1,36), (2,18), (3,12), (4,9), (6,6)
How can a factor tree show if a number is prime or composite?
If the number breaks down into more than one factor pair, it’s composite.
